Homemade Bread, Healthy and Fun

Homemade bread is hearty, and inexpensive.

To create made in the home a bread loaf you will need the essential ingredients of flour, water, yeast, salt, and which size bread loaf tin you would like to use. This recipe will use the standard bread loaf tin, available in any five-and-dime.

For an easily done homespun bread loaf recipe you will need: 3/4 oz. dried active yeast, 2 cups warm water, 2 pounds bread flour, and 1 tbsp. salt. Have some extra flour nearby for dusting.

Immediately comes the mixing step. Mix your yeast in with your warm water until well dissolved. In a large bowl, mix the salt with most of the flour, but not all. Mix the water into circa one pound of the salted flour mixture. Mix well so it is well included, then add the excess of the salted flour mixture. Persist to mix until it is all well fused. You want the dough to be smooth, but not sticky. Keep on to knead the dough until this is reached. You should end up with an elastic very smooth dough. Persist in to add the flour mixture at a slow pace until this density has been reached, and the dough does not stick to the bowl.

Now you have to let the bread ferment. Mold your dough into a smooth ball, set it into a well greased bowl, and safeguard it with a clean towel. It should be set in a warm area to rise. You want your dough to be doubled in size, and when you jab it the dough does not spring back at you.

Straightaway remove the dough from the bowl, and roll it out onto a sparingly dusted cutting board, and roll out the excess gases. Determine how many bread loaf tins you will use, and mete out the dough apart accordingly. Cover with a clean lint free towel. Let settle for just a few minutes.

Then shape your dough to the close size and shape of your bread loaf tins. You do this by shaping and stretching the dough with your hands. Locate the dough in the bread loaf tin and one more time cover with a fresh towel to ferment some more. You want the dough to again double in size.

Now you are equipped to cook in oven. Preheat your oven to 375 degrees. Loaves, in a bread loaf tin, can take up to 30 minutes of bake time. You will know it is finished when it is an agreeable golden brown color, and when you hit lightly it, it sounds hollowed out. .
